I rushed through the first 10 minutes of the demo before going to university - and I was late, lol.
I gotta say it's pretty hard at first. Probably because of the wobbly-ness of the physics. But I got used to it after a while.
What I didn't get used to is the soundtrack. It's much more irritating than in the gameplay videos and doesn't provide an atmosphere at all. I liked the background artwork (not so much the characters). It is, however, very uninspiring.
Not much atmosphere to be found here, in my opinion. :/
I'll still play the rest of the demo and rip the music, but I don't think I'll play any more of it after I finish it and the final game 100%.
That may change depending on the rest of the demo/game, of course.
